The menstual cycle is a 28-day cycle of the female reproductive system.

It starts on day 1, this is the first day of menstruation for the woman.

Menstruation typically lasts between 5 to 7 days. During this time the hormone FSH is produced from the pituitary gland. FSH causes an ovum to mature in the ovary.

Once menstruation has finished, FSH stimulates the hormone oestrogen to be released from the ovary.
